More about the Senior Quantity Surveyor role…Lead, support and coach your direct reports and the wider team to support their growth and development
Collaborate with Land, Technical, Development and Construction teams, attending project and design meetings to provide commercial input and identify cost risks and opportunities.
Review contract documentation, drawings and programme requirements to identify errors, omissions, risks, delays, extensions of time, loss and expense events, and potential cost impacts.
Manage the tendering and procurement process, including preparing tender documentation, evaluating submissions, completing CV1/CV2 approvals, conducting adjudications and ensuring compliance with Group policy and best practice.
Negotiate, place and administer subcontract orders, including pre-order meetings, contractual documentation, subcontractor due diligence and approval processes.
Manage variations, sales extras, site instructions and development changes, ensuring accurate valuation, approval, reporting and cost recovery.
Prepare, monitor and control development budgets, cost plans, forecasts and cash flow, identifying risks, opportunities and areas of overspend.
Produce and present commercial and financial reporting, including CVRs, valuations, liability reports, margin analysis, cost-to-complete forecasts, turnover forecasts and site-specific commercial reviews.
Assess, value and certify subcontractor payments, variations, retentions and final accounts, ensuring compliance with contractual obligations, company procedures and relevant legislation.
Maintain accurate commercial records and reporting systems, including orders, valuations, reserves, forecasts, payment schedules and project administration within company systems.
Monitor subcontractor performance and contractual compliance, supporting dispute resolution, claims management and commercial risk mitigation.
